Four Seasons Health Care: Residential & Nursing Care Services
Residential Care
Four Seasons provides residential care services to seniors who need assistance with daily activities, such as bathing, dressing, and medication management. Residential care homes are typically smaller and more intimate than nursing homes, and they provide a more home-like environment.
Nursing Care
Four Seasons also provides nursing care services to seniors who need more intensive medical attention. Nursing care homes are staffed with registered nurses and licensed practical nurses who can provide a variety of medical services, including wound care, IV therapy, and respiratory therapy.
Rehabilitation Services
Four Seasons offers rehabilitation services to seniors who are recovering from surgery, an illness, or an injury. Rehabilitation services can include physical therapy, occupational therapy, and speech therapy.
Home Care Services
Four Seasons provides home care services to seniors who want to remain living at home but need some assistance with daily activities. Home care services can include bathing, dressing, medication management, and transportation to appointments.
Memory Care Services
Four Seasons offers memory care services to seniors who have been diagnosed with Alzheimer's disease or another form of dementia. Memory care homes are designed to provide a safe and supportive environment for seniors who are living with memory loss.
